About SSM Health St. Anthony Hospital - Oklahoma City

Located in midtown, SSM Health St. Anthony Hospital - Oklahoma City serves the health care needs of central Oklahoma and its surrounding counties. We offer a wide range of services with physicians and staff dedicated to providing exceptional care. Our specialties include: cardiology, oncology, surgery, and behavioral health medicine.

Community Description

Oklahoma City's metro area, long known for its western heritage and cattle stockyards, is experiencing an exciting period of revitalization and growth. Today, more businesses and young families are flocking into the city limits and making this area their home. The city is developing into a more cosmopolitan center with diverse dining opportunities, entertainment, museums and sporting events. The city, as well as the surrounding suburbs, are home to tight-knit communities and neighborhoods that are welcoming to new residents and families.

With its perfect blend of small town hospitality and metropolitan amenities, Oklahoma City may very well be America s biggest small town.
